Hi there...It would be really kind if someone could help me regarding the following issues please. As this is my first post and hence im very new to things regarding satellite...

I have just purchased a digital satellite receiver Technosat T6000 plus which I guess comes with 2 cam slots and 1 card slot. I stay in an apartment, therefore we have a common sky dish on the roof. I connected my receiver to the wall socket and searched on Astra, Hotbird and other satellites...and the result was I got all the sky channels but only very few (shopping channels) were free...all the others were scrambled I guess as it had a "dollar" sign next to it. I would appreciate if anyone could help me on how to receive those locked channels please..Many thanks!

You can receive some of the encrypted channels (free to view) by picking up an activated Freesat card on ebay and buying yourself a dragon CAM to put it into. Otherwise you are stuffed, as Sky is not hacked.
